Lockstitch sewing machines are used for sewing light to medium weight fabrics, and are commonly used to sew jeans, most types of upholstery, and many types of athletic wear. Distinct from a chain stitch machine, a lockstitch sewing machine makes strong, straight seams. A lockstitch sewing machine is a type of machine that is commonly used in the textile industry to create a secure and durable stitch. A lockstitch sewing machine binds cloth together with two spools of thread and a needle with the eye at its base.
